Home / Support / Turning Missed Call Alert on/off
Turning Missed Call Alert on/off

To turn Missed Call Alert on, simply dial 1710.

To turn Missed Call Alert off, simply dial 1760.


Important Note
Activating Call Alert will overwrite any current diverts, such as Voicemail 901.
